Peter Drucker1 once observed, “Whenever you see a successful business, someone once made a courageous decision.” In today’s rapidly changing, often-volatile mar-ketplace, where uncertainty is frequently a daunting characteristic of business competition, those making decisions need to be courageous and agile. In fact, business agility is increasingly a defining characteristic of those organizations that thrive in today’s commercial environment. What is it? How does one attain it?

In a Harvard Business Review article, Donald Sull, visiting professor of strategy and entrepreneurship at the London Business School, defined organizational agility as a company’s ability to consistently identify and capture business opportunities more quickly than its rivals do.2 Sull breaks down three types of organizational agility:

• OPERATIONAL: within a focused business model, consistently identifying and seizing opportunities more quickly than competitors.

• PORTFOLIO: quickly shifting resources from less-promising businesses into more-attractive alternatives.

• STRATEGIC: identifying and seizing game-changing opportunities when they arrive.

From our perspective, all these approaches require true business agility, a capa-bility fostered by being as close as possible to one’s business, having maximum flexibility to respond to events as they emerge, and being able to capitalize on change. When an organization has this capability, those driving it can make decisions to move the company successfully forward into the future, confi-dently and courageously.

MEETING THE DEMAND FOR INDUSTRY-SPECIFIC FUNCTIONALITYA recent survey of manufacturing executives conducted by IFS and analyst Cindy Jutras found that 67 percent of them required industry-specific functionality in enterprise applications, and even those that didn’t still expressed a desire for it.3 Those who required industry-specific functionality were 12 percent less likely to have implemented ERP than those who did not, indicating that the lack of a proper solution fit caused some to delay the investment in enterprise technology.

The study determined that the types of processes a business was involved in were a key indicator of which businesses required greater industry- specific functionality: Those involved with extensive customer collaboration in high value, complex projects reported a greater need, as did those involved with man-agement of large fixed assets (think heavy duty machinery) and service management. Among those companies with the most pronounced need for greater specialized functionality were those where managing return on assets is a core discipline. The need for ERP with enterprise asset manage-ment (EAM) or enterprise service management (ESM) functionality creates a “perfect storm” that many enterprise solutions do not handle well.

Lack of industry-specific functionality negatively impacted enterprise technology in several ways, including lower productivity through additional non-value added work and lack of visibility across the enterprise.

No solution handles this storm better than IFS Applications 9, which includes ERP, EAM, and ESM functionality for specific industries, such as aerospace and defense, automotive, construction and contracting, energy and

EXTENDING FUNCTIONALITY WITH EMBEDDED CRMIFS Applications has long offered a tightly integrated CRM solution, allowing a back office approach to CRM. Rather than just contact management, this approach has allowed our customers access to operational data by customer —essential in project-driven activities like engineer-to-order (ETO) and engineering, procurement and construction (EPC), or simply for improving communication with customers. When you have that customer on the phone, integration with finance can let you know if there are outstanding invoices. Integration with engineering gives you visibility into design projects you may be engaged in together. CRM has been a strength for IFS Applications, but this has not been a perfect world. Any integration becomes an issue when setting up more complex relationships (e.g. from opportunity to sales to contract delivery), and changes to operational processes require some consulting or systems integration work.

While we have long offered CRM tightly integrated with ERP and the rest of the enterprise suite, we take this a step further with IFS Applications 9 by completely embedding CRM into the application suite. No longer are we moving data back and forth between different applications through replication or duplication. Data is now available in real time, which improves insight, customer service and more.

Again, this moves IFS Applications 9 further away from the rest of the pack in terms of the ability to deliver back-office, strategic CRM. Any solution touting truly embedded CRM must answer the following questions affirmatively:

• Is it the same user experience regardless of where I access CRM data?

• Can I log into the same client and move back and forth without multiple applications?

• Can I see CRM data from my back office in real time?

• Do the back-office components offer the same potential to extend the data model and user experience as does the CRM product? CRM is generally highly extensible, and in fully embedded CRM this flexibility must cut across to the rest of the application suite.

LAYERED ARCHITECTURE: NO MORE “STANDARD VERSUS CUSTOMIZED” CONUNDRUMIn attempting to be agile, one historical problem for companies from an IT perspective has been the time and cost of rolling out and incorporating technological advances. Companies struggle to stay updated, largely because they’ve modified their solution. Those modifications must be uplifted to each new version of the software, increasing the cost and complexity of upgrades. Naturally, this is a disincentive to staying current on version and adopting new, beneficial, technologies and functionality. However, IFS Applications 9 incorporates layered application architecture to address this problem.

The first line of defense must always be to avoid modifications. After all, the right business solution will include sufficient industry-specific functionality to meet core business requirements, and indeed, may encompass best practices a company in your industry would do well to adopt. The second line of defense is to achieve the effect of modifications through configuration, which is less expensive and disruptive than modifications to code. For example, IFS customers are avoiding and eliminating existing modifications by leveraging custom fields, which were added in IFS Applications 8. These custom fields are made even more powerful in IFS Applications 9, which offers custom objects, pages, relationships, business rules and other features designed to give customers the ability to extend and adapt the data model as well as user experience through configuration.

IFS Applications 9 introduces a third line of defense—an elegant approach to dealing with the few modifications that may be legitimately necessary to meet very specific requirements unique to a given company or niche industry. If customization is needed, it is now done in a separate layer, making it simpler to upgrade the standard product because the modifications no longer need to be uplifted. It’s faster, easier, less expensive, and better suited to capitalize on technological gains.

Traditionally, companies have faced a difficult choice: choose a standard solution and accept compromises and manual workarounds or modify the source code and pay significantly more. The use of a layered application architecture, custom fields and objects and deep industry-specific functionality eliminates this either-or dilemma.

This is particularly important with the proliferation of customers running IFS Applications in the cloud, where the pace of change is faster and the appli-cations are being administered by a third party not intimately familiar with your business and modifications. Leveraging a layered application architecture is a big part of the answer.

IFS Applications 9 delivers two new exciting pieces of functionality to provide flexible real-time visibility into the business for all users—IFS Streams™ and IFS Lobby.

Each of us has to work to remember to follow up on things. Perhaps we write notes to ourselves, put sticky notes on our screen, send ourselves an email, or book something on our calendar. But we are all trying to get away from manual follow-up, which is why we offer subscriptions in IFS Streams. Let’s say there was a purchase order that was delayed and I really need to know ASAP when the goods I have ordered arrive. Before, I would have had to make a note to myself to remember to go back and check the status of that purchase order later on. With IFS Streams, it is a simple matter for an end user to sub-scribe to status changes for that purchase order. This is something I can do myself in a couple of clicks with no assistance from IT. In addition to sub-scriptions, IFS Streams also folds in notifications (for example when someone replies to one of your posts) from our IFS Talk™ enterprise social module, and notifications of new tasks you are assigned. Notifications and other objects in IFS Streams offer drill-down capabilities to the screens where the requisite action can be taken.
